Supplies Needed

  • Small terra cotta pot
  • White paint
  • Burlap
  • Rustic twine
  • Ribbon
  • White paper
  • Googly eyes
  • Blackness marker
  • Hot glue gun
  • Hot glue sticks or hot glue rope
  • Scissors
  • Paintbrush

How to Make an Upcycled Flower Pot Easter Bunny

Start by painting your terracotta flower pot white. Fix the flower pot aside to dry.

Now, cut out two ears shapes from the burlap.

Using the burlap as templates, cut out 2 white ear shapes slightly smaller than the burlap ears.

At present, you will gum these together.

Attach the ears to the back of the flower pot as shown with the opening of the pot facing downward.

Add together a pink bow or ribbon between the ears.

Now, you will glue on the googly optics.

Add a few pieces of twine with a pink pom pom for nose and whiskers.

Using a blackness mark, depict on the smiling.
